Engagement Roll Forward Analysis
Roll a completed analysis forward into an existing engagement. This will create a new analysis within the target engagement using the source analysis’ data as prior period data for the new analysis.
For analyses using a non-periodic time frame, this will create a new current analysis period, with the existing data being added as prior period data. This new current period can be configured to either be a full period, or an interim period.
Analyses that use the periodic time frame will be rolled forward into a new periodic time frame, and will not have a new period added.
Rolling forward is subject to the following restrictions:
- The target engagement must not be the same as the analysis’ current engagement.
- Only completed analyses can be rolled forward.
- Interim analyses cannot be rolled forward. This does not apply to interim analyses that have been converted to full-period analyses.
- The library of the target engagement must support the analysis type of the analysis.
